writeprotect,ichspi,spi25: handle register access constraints
Make the spi25 register read/write functions return SPI_INVALID_OPCODE
if the programmer blocks the read/write opcode for the register.
Likewise, make ichspi read/write register functions return
SPI_INVALID_OPCODE for registers >SR1 as they cannot be accessd.
Make writeprotect ignore SPI_INVALID_OPCODE unless it is trying to
read/write SR1, which should always be supported.

tree/: Move programmer_delay() out of programmer state machine
Handle the special cases of both serprog and ch341a_spi.
Also rewrite programmer_delay() to handle the two base
cases of zero time and no valid flashctx yet before
handling per master branching.
Additionally, modify the custom delay function pointer
signature to allow closure over the flashctx. This allows
driver specific delay implementations to recover programmer
specific opaque data within their delay implementations.
Therefore programmer specific delay functions can avoid
programmer specific globals.
